====== Wiki Spammers ====== It seems my sites have (once again) been targeted again by some wiki spammers (people or bots, who cares). Discouraging. I'd rather be writing, but maybe that's a pipe dream when attempted on the Internet. These spammers seem to be link farmers, trying to spread links to their phish/malware sites by automatically loading them anyplace they can write to, and hoping that the search bots will harvest them up. The sad part is, its not even worth chasing or reporting them, because its all automated from zombie bot-infected computers anyway.
